Leading realtor developer Brigade Enterprises has entered into management agreements with Hyatt Hotels Corporation for two hospitality projects. The deals cover a beachfront hotel on Chennai’s East Coast Road and a serviced apartment complex in Devanahalli, Bengaluru.

The agreements mark Brigade Group’s first partnership with Hyatt, adding the American hospitality giant to its existing operator roster of Marriott, Accor and InterContinental Hotels Group.

Grand Hyatt on Chennai’s beachfront

Brigade Hotel Ventures Ltd (BHVL), a subsidiary of Brigade Enterprises, signed the pact for a 200-key Grand Hyatt Chennai ECR. The property, located on the southeastern coastline, is slated to open in 2029.

The hotel will cater to premium leisure and business travellers, with a focused thrust on MICE, weddings and staycations.

Hyatt House To serve Devanahalli’s growing tech corridor

BCV Developers Pvt Ltd, another Brigade group entity, signed for a 135-unit Hyatt House Bengaluru Devanahalli, targeting a 2027 opening. It is located about 20 minutes from Kempegowda International Airport.

Brigade Moves Up The Brand Ladder

BHVL currently operates nine hotels totalling 1,604 keys across Bengaluru, Chennai, Kochi, Mysuru and GIFT City, spanning upper upscale to midscale segments.

Grand Hyatt’s global MICE equity and Hyatt House’s extended-stay positioning fill gaps that Brigade’s current operator mix has left open.
